The Sangoma A104 board: Four spans of optimized voice and data over T1, E1, and J1 lines. This 4 port PRI Digital card supports up to 120 voice calls or 8.192 Mbps of full–duplex data throughput over four T1, E1, or J1 lines.

  • Technical Specifications

    • Line Protocols: Voice CAS, MFC/R2, PRI, ATM, Frame Relay, X.25, HDLC, PPP, SS7, Transparent bit-stream, BSC
    • Higher Level Protocols: IP/IPX over Frame Relay/PPP/HDLC/X.25, X.25 over Frame Relay (Annex G), BSC over X.25, SNA over X.25, PPPoE,PPPoA, IP over ATM
    • Diagnostic Tools: WANPIPEMON, SNMP, system logs
    • Warranty: Lifetime warranty on parts and labour. Plus a 30-day no questions asked return policy.
    • Production Quality: ISO 9002
    • One T1/E1 span with optimum PCI or PCI-Express interface for high performance voice and data applications
    • Dimensions: 2U Form factor: 120 mm x 55 mm for use in restricted chassis. Includes high-quality, tested RJ45 cables and short 2U mounting clips for installation in 2U rack-mount servers
    • Includes high-quality, tested RJ45 cables and short 2U mounting clips for installation in 2U rack-mount servers
    • Intelligent hardware: Downloadable FPGA programming with multiple operating modes. Add new features related to voice and/or data when they become available.
    • Autosense compatibility with 5 V and 3.3 V PCI busses
    • Line decoding: HDB3, AMI, B8ZS
    • Framing: CRC-4, Non CRC4, ESF, SF, D4. Also compatible with Japan’s J1.
    • A101E and A101DE PCI Express: 1 Lane PCI Express bus
    • Maximum operational power for PCI: 3 W (0.6 A @ 5 V) For PCI Express: 2.5 W (0.76 A @ 3.3 V)
    • Temperature range: 0 – 50 °C
    • 32-bit bus master DMA data exchanges across PCI interface at 132 Mbytes/sec for minimum host processor intervention
    • Ring buffer DMA handling for minimum host intervention and guaranteed data integrity on high volume systems

     

    Operating Systems

    • Windows® 2003, Windows® XP, Windows® Server 2008, Windows® Vista, Windows® 7
    • Linux (all versions, releases and distributions from 1.0 up)

    T1/E1 Status Alarms

    • RED: Telco Red Alarm Condition
    • OOF: Out of Frame
    • LOS: Receive Loss of Signal
    • AIS: Alarm Indication Signal
    • RAI: Remote Alarm Indication (Yellow Alarm)
